User manual
684
mikoC PRO for dsPIC
MikroElektronika
Vector_Add
Prototype
void Vector_Add(unsigned *dest, unsigned *v1, unsigned *v2, unsigned
numElems);
Description Function calculates vector addition.
dstV[n] = srcV1[n] + srcV2[n] , n ϵ [0, numElems-1)
Parameters - dest: pointer to result vector
- v1: pointer to rst vector
- v2: pointer to second vector
- numElemsV1: number of vector(s) elements
Returns Nothing.
Requires Nothing.
Example
unsigned vec1[3] = {1,2,3};
unsigned vec2[3] = {1,1,1};
unsigned vecDest[3];
Vector_Add(vecDest, vec1, vec2, 3);
Notes - [W0..W4] used, not restored
- AccuA used, not restored
- CORCON saved, used, restored